The Rhody Ramble is kicking off its 2013 season with activities during April school vacation week (April 13-21). Launched in 2012 as a summer family adventure around Rhode Island, the Rhody Ramble has expanded to include a nearly year-round calendar of events for children and families. 

In 2013, events and tours are offered at 25 member properties of the Historic Sites Coalition of Rhode Island, which are located throughout the state. Events include outdoor festivals, concerts, re-enactments, hands-on activities, scavenger hunts and walking tours. Explore Rhode Island’s diverse history and landscape – including oceanfront mansions, farms, an observatory, a lighthouse and even a historic jail!
